SOURCE: 2002 buick century remote keyless trunk control
First off, Check for obstuction/s in or around solenoid drive drive rod.Second,if no problem found.clean up and lubricate contact jaws with white lithium grease. and you should be good to go. While you have the grease in your hand LUBRICATE the door strikers too. Hope this cures you ailment

SOURCE: both key fobs and the trunk button inthe glove box
First thing to do is check the fuse panel and make certain the fuse to the pwr trunk release is not blown.
Secondly, open the trunk with the key and verify that the trunk latch hoop and surrounding area are clean and free of debris.
